Disparities in adolescent controller medication adherence, treatment barriers, and asthma control

Rachel Sweenie,
Lori E. Crosby,
Theresa W. Guilbert
et al.

Abstract: BackgroundDisparities in asthma persist despite advances in interventions. Adherence and self‐management behaviors are critical yet challenging during adolescence. Treatment barriers include individual factors as well as structural and social determinants of health.ObjectiveTo determine differences in controller medication adherence, asthma control, and treatment barriers by race, income, and insurance and whether racial disparities persist when controlling for income and insurance.
